after quite a lengthy time without really delving into the comic world, with distractions subsiding, i've recently returned and to my delight there are a lot of new great titles. some of what i've been reading is:
- saga. epic, should certainly be considered for a major film. up to #7. love the tv men...just an overall excellent title that i think most could find interest in.
- ex machina. read the whole run quickly, loved it but the concept wore on me by the end along with the flash writing style. still strong stuff.
- planetoid. read the 5 issue run, great little action movie that takes the road warrior base character and twists him up in lots of interesting ways. another one i could see as film. i plan to show a few of my friends this title
- the manhattan projects. can hickman do nothing wrong? just amazing storytelling, compelling artwork and very real characters. my favourite title as of yet since my return to reading.
- dancer. on #3/4. great anti hero burnout story that has been the base of a lot of great comics in the last few years, was similar to brubaker's action mysteries.
- ten grand #1. classic movie style story intro, interested to see where this one goes. looks like it'll be deep into the occult, on par with max payne 1.
as you can see, i've become pretty much an Image guy. just great titles that take small risks that seriously pay off. the author also just seems closer to the reader when you know the artist owns his project. excited to find new titles and i can't say i miss marvel and dc's main titles yet.
